About VXL
VXL is one of the world’s largest 
suppliers of thin clients. Established 
in 1976, VXL has grown steadily 
and now has over three hundred 
people worldwide – with offices in 
Germany, France, India, the United 
States and the United Kingdom. 
The company’s headquarters are in 
Bangalore, India.

Green Credentials
With an average power consumption of 
only 18.2 watts, the Itona is more than 4 
times more efficient than a PC. It is also 
substantially lower than almost all its 
competitors.
